GNU bug report logs - #58604
[PATCH] Fix x11 with i18n build

Previous Next

Package: emacs;

Reported by: Randy Taylor <dev <at> rjt.dev>

Date: Tue, 18 Oct 2022 01:47:01 UTC

Severity: normal

Tags: patch

Done: Stefan Kangas <stefankangas <at> gmail.com>

Bug is archived. No further changes may be made.

To add a comment to this bug, you must first unarchive it, by sending
a message to control AT debbugs.gnu.org, with unarchive 58604 in the body.
You can then email your comments to 58604 AT debbugs.gnu.org in the normal way.

Toggle the display of automated, internal messages from the tracker.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to bug-gnu-emacs <at> gnu.org:
bug#58604; Package emacs. (Tue, 18 Oct 2022 01:47:01 GMT) Full text and rfc822 format available.

Acknowledgement sent to Randy Taylor <dev <at> rjt.dev>:
New bug report received and forwarded. Copy sent to bug-gnu-emacs <at> gnu.org. (Tue, 18 Oct 2022 01:47:01 GMT) Full text and rfc822 format available.

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Randy Taylor <dev <at> rjt.dev>
To: "bug-gnu-emacs <at> gnu.org" <bug-gnu-emacs <at> gnu.org>
Subject: [PATCH] Fix x11 with i18n build
Date: Tue, 18 Oct 2022 01:46:09 +0000
[Message part 1 (text/plain, inline)]
With no toolkit, no xrandr, no xinput2 and having i18n, the dpyinfo variable is not created but is used later on, causing the build to fail.

The attached patch fixes the problem.

FYI I should have copyright assignment on file.
[Message part 2 (text/html, inline)]
[0001-src-xterm.c-mark_xterm-Fix-x11-with-i18n-build.patch (text/x-patch, attachment)]

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#58604; Package emacs. (Tue, 18 Oct 2022 11:02:02 GMT) Full text and rfc822 format available.

Message #8 received at 58604 <at> debbugs.gnu.org (full text, mbox):

From: Po Lu <luangruo <at> yahoo.com>
To: Randy Taylor <dev <at> rjt.dev>
Cc: 58604 <at> debbugs.gnu.org
Subject: Re: bug#58604: [PATCH] Fix x11 with i18n build
Date: Tue, 18 Oct 2022 19:00:45 +0800
Randy Taylor <dev <at> rjt.dev> writes:

> With no toolkit, no xrandr, no xinput2 and having i18n, the dpyinfo variable is not created but is used later on, causing the build to fail.
>
> The attached patch fixes the problem.
>
> FYI I should have copyright assignment on file.

Thanks.  Would someone please confirm either that, or that you are
currently within the 15-line copyright assignment exemption?




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#58604; Package emacs. (Tue, 18 Oct 2022 14:56:02 GMT) Full text and rfc822 format available.

Message #11 received at 58604 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Po Lu <luangruo <at> yahoo.com>
Cc: 58604 <at> debbugs.gnu.org, dev <at> rjt.dev
Subject: Re: bug#58604: [PATCH] Fix x11 with i18n build
Date: Tue, 18 Oct 2022 17:55:23 +0300
> Cc: 58604 <at> debbugs.gnu.org
> Date: Tue, 18 Oct 2022 19:00:45 +0800
> From:  Po Lu via "Bug reports for GNU Emacs,
>  the Swiss army knife of text editors" <bug-gnu-emacs <at> gnu.org>
> 
> Randy Taylor <dev <at> rjt.dev> writes:
> 
> > With no toolkit, no xrandr, no xinput2 and having i18n, the dpyinfo variable is not created but is used later on, causing the build to fail.
> >
> > The attached patch fixes the problem.
> >
> > FYI I should have copyright assignment on file.
> 
> Thanks.  Would someone please confirm either that, or that you are
> currently within the 15-line copyright assignment exemption?

Assignment is on file; confirmed.




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#58604; Package emacs. (Wed, 19 Oct 2022 00:55:01 GMT) Full text and rfc822 format available.

Message #14 received at 58604 <at> debbugs.gnu.org (full text, mbox):

From: Po Lu <luangruo <at> yahoo.com>
To: Eli Zaretskii <eliz <at> gnu.org>
Cc: 58604 <at> debbugs.gnu.org, dev <at> rjt.dev
Subject: Re: bug#58604: [PATCH] Fix x11 with i18n build
Date: Wed, 19 Oct 2022 08:54:08 +0800
Eli Zaretskii <eliz <at> gnu.org> writes:

> Assignment is on file; confirmed.

OK, I will install this now.




Information forwarded to bug-gnu-emacs <at> gnu.org:
bug#58604; Package emacs. (Wed, 19 Oct 2022 01:09:01 GMT) Full text and rfc822 format available.

Message #17 received at 58604 <at> debbugs.gnu.org (full text, mbox):

From: Randy Taylor <dev <at> rjt.dev>
To: Po Lu <luangruo <at> yahoo.com>
Cc: 58604 <at> debbugs.gnu.org, Eli Zaretskii <eliz <at> gnu.org>
Subject: Re: bug#58604: [PATCH] Fix x11 with i18n build
Date: Wed, 19 Oct 2022 01:08:03 +0000
On Tuesday, October 18th, 2022 at 20:54, Po Lu <luangruo <at> yahoo.com> wrote:
> OK, I will install this now.

Thanks!




Reply sent to Stefan Kangas <stefankangas <at> gmail.com>:
You have taken responsibility. (Fri, 11 Nov 2022 13:29:03 GMT) Full text and rfc822 format available.

Notification sent to Randy Taylor <dev <at> rjt.dev>:
bug acknowledged by developer. (Fri, 11 Nov 2022 13:29:03 GMT) Full text and rfc822 format available.

Message #22 received at 58604-done <at> debbugs.gnu.org (full text, mbox):

From: Stefan Kangas <stefankangas <at> gmail.com>
To: Po Lu <luangruo <at> yahoo.com>
Cc: 58604-done <at> debbugs.gnu.org, dev <at> rjt.dev, Eli Zaretskii <eliz <at> gnu.org>
Subject: Re: bug#58604: [PATCH] Fix x11 with i18n build
Date: Fri, 11 Nov 2022 05:28:11 -0800
Po Lu <luangruo <at> yahoo.com> writes:

> Eli Zaretskii <eliz <at> gnu.org> writes:
>
>> Assignment is on file; confirmed.
>
> OK, I will install this now.

This was installed as 620f18c489ff9ce3d0a4afe04d438a1bc0525e73.

It seems the bug was left opened, closing now.




bug archived. Request was from Debbugs Internal Request <help-debbugs <at> gnu.org> to internal_control <at> debbugs.gnu.org. (Sat, 10 Dec 2022 12:24:05 GMT) Full text and rfc822 format available.

This bug report was last modified 2 years and 249 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.